Last Person in Connection with Mostar Murder detained

Published: February 23, 2026
Share
SHARE

Police officers of the Police Directorate of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of the Herzegovina-Neretva Canton, Criminal Police Sector, have deprived of liberty a person who is linked to the murder of M.D. (1983) from Bugojno.

The murder occurred on February 14 this year in the Mostar neighborhood of Zalik, and a person with the initials S.G. (1999) from Mostar was deprived of liberty. This is the last person linked to the murder of M.D.

During the official measures and actions taken, a firearm (pistol) was seized from the suspect, which is linked to the commission of the aforementioned criminal offense, the cantonal Ministry of Internal Affairs announced.

A criminal investigation was conducted on the suspect, and a report was drawn up on the committed criminal offenses of “Murder” and “Unauthorized acquisition, possession or sale of weapons or essential parts for weapons”.

The suspect will be handed over to the acting prosecutor of the Mostar Cantonal Prosecutor’s Office for further action during the day, the statement said.
